Photographer Josef Scaylea (1913-2004) worked for 35 years as chief photographer for the Seattle Times, winning over 1000 awards for his photographs highlighting the scenery and people in the Pacific Northwest. He donated a collection of his photographs and photography equipment to MOHAI in 1993.

Scaylea took this photo of Roosevelt High School student Biff Borenson practicing his trick skiing at the Sand Point (Seattle) Golf Club on a snow day after a heavy snowfall.

Handwritten on image: Josef Scaylea.
Handwritten on verso: News Feature - Snow closes Seattle Schools. 1972. Biff Borenson, Roosevelt HS student, Practices his trick skiing at the Sand Point (Seattle) Golf Club after the heavy snowfall of Jan. 1972.
